Oscar Tshiebwe, in full also Oscar Tshiebwe, was born on November 27, 1999, in Lubumbashi, DR Congo. He stands tall at six-foot-nine inches and has a seven-foot-five wingspan. Tshiebwe led Kennedy Catholic to a 243 record and the PIAA Class 6A championship in his senior season, averaging 23.4 points, 18 rebounds, and five blocks per game. If there's a will, there's a way. As stated by TheAthletic: "Tshiebwe was the first player in program history to win all six NCAA-recognized player awards (Sporting News, Associated Press, United States Basketball Association, National Association of Basketball Coaches, Naismith Trophy and Wooden Award).". Tshiebwe moved to the U.S. before his freshman year of high school to chase his dream of playing in the NBA, and he did not speak a word of English when he arrived.
